Job Title: Traveling Construction Laborer

Job Description

We are seeking a skilled construction laborer who will assist with tunnel work and is willing to travel. The ideal candidate will have experience with various types of construction projects, including water/wastewater, mining, transportation, commercial and residential building, energy, tunneling, and marine. A strong work ethic and willingness to learn are essential.

Responsibilities

  • Assist with tunnel construction work.
  • Travel to various construction sites as required.
  • Participate in a variety of construction projects, such as water/wastewater management, mining, transportation, commercial and residential building, energy projects, tunneling, and marine construction.
  • Ensure construction safety and adhere to all safety protocols.
  • Conduct trench digging and underground utility work.
  • Perform concrete finishing and concrete pours.
  • Engage in demolition and pipeline construction activities.

Essential Skills

  • 2+ years of commercial construction experience.
  • Experience in construction safety and commercial building.
  • Proficiency in concrete finishing and concrete pours.
  • Knowledge of trench digging and underground utilities.

Additional Skills & Qualifications

  • Previous experience with underground utility work is a plus.
